Alexandru Nazare, Minister of Finance, said that ANAF is dysfunctional and that abuses by inspectors are nothing new, stressing the need for reform.

Speaking to Digi24, Alexandru Nazare highlighted ANAF's persistent problems, citing abuses and a lack of willingness to reform. Although ANAF's leadership has been changed, Nazare stressed that the institution remains dysfunctional and below average in revenue collection in the region. The digitalization of ANAF is lagging behind, and his conclusions come amid the scandal involving Deputy Prime Minister Dragos Anastasiu, linked to corruption within ANAF.
